We advise a minimum of at least 10 hours of study per week, OUTSIDE class. Also, during the first week, the number of study hours will probably be even higher as you adjust to the viewpoint of the course and brush up on precalculus/algebra skills. In effect, this means that Math 125 will be at least a 15 hour per week effort; almost the ... Systems of linear equations, …Math 125. Textbook. Math 125 covers chapters 1 - 6 and section 7.1 of Calculus, Single Variable; 6th edition; Hughes-Hallett, et al.; Wiley. Calculators. A graphing calculator is required for Math 125. We recommend any model in the TI-83 or TI-84 series. Models that can perform symbolic calculations (also known as CAS) are NOT allowed on exams ...
